Association News: Good360, A Resource to Engage Membership

 

  Donor News Archive

 

As Good360 continues to grow, our partnerships with national and international associations have become increasingly diverse.

Many associations find that offering Good360 as a resource for donating inventory is an engagement strategy for their membership. Other associations, who want to stand out as an industry leader, have the opportunity to create cause campaigns with Good360 to rally behind a certain cause (i.e., “Home Sweet Home” by the Association of Home Appliance Manufacturers and “Start Clean” by the Soap and Detergent Association). Finally, many associations find that during times of disaster, Good360 can connect association members to provide aide to impacted communities, therefore increasing the philanthropy and goodwill of the association and its membership. Retail Industry Leaders Association (RILA)
Good360 has partnered with RILA on a number of initiatives. We were recently featured in the RILA newsletter, highlighting our retail donation partnership program, Framing Hope, with The Home Depot Foundation. Additionally, we recently presented a joint webinar with RILA entitled, “Converting Waste to Donations: Sustainability through Partnership.” This gave RILA members the opportunity to learn about the benefits of product giving from multiple perspectives—corporate social responsibility, sustainability and waste diversion, financial and tax benefits, and employee engagement. Finally, Good360 will exhibit at the Retail Sustainability Conference this October 12-14 in Orlando, Florida. The Worldwide Cleaning Industry Association (ISSA)
Since 1995, exhibitors in the ISSA annual convention (now ISSA/INTERCLEAN® North America) have donated samples and remaining display products to those in need within the show's convention host city. Since 1998, the supplies have been gathered by Good360 for distribution to local nonprofit agencies. ISSA exhibitors consistently donate more than $70,000 in product. The Good360 donation program will again be conducted at the upcoming ISSA/INTERCLEAN® North America tradeshow in Las Vegas, October 18-21. The International Housewares Association (IHA)
To assist victims of tornadoes and floods that have recently devastated Missouri, Alabama, Tennessee and Georgia, IHA has partnered with Good360 to spread the word through its membership. Local emergency relief organizations have determined that these communities need a wide array of housewares items. Good360 has assessed what items are needed and has welcomed product donations from IHA membership that match the needs of these communities. In addition to providing support for those in distress, donations of needed housewares products may be eligible for an enhanced tax benefit.
